Payroll services in Gauteng — questions employers ask
Which areas of Gauteng does Patuza cover?
Patuza serves employers in every metropolitan, district and local municipality in Gauteng — around 91 cities, towns, suburbs and regions in total. Payroll is processed remotely, so coverage does not depend on how far you are from a branch.
What does a payroll service in Gauteng include?
Monthly or weekly payroll processing, BCEA-compliant payslips, PAYE, UIF and SDL calculations, EMP201 submissions, bi-annual EMP501 reconciliations, UI-19 declarations, COIDA returns, leave and overtime administration, bargaining-council submissions where they apply, and payroll journals for your accountant.
How quickly can payroll start in Gauteng?
Standard onboarding takes one pay cycle. We collect employee master data, year-to-date balances and your SARS registration details (PAYE, UIF, SDL and COIDA references), run a parallel calculation for verification, then go live.
Is Patuza registered to submit to SARS on my behalf?
Yes. Patuza acts as your registered tax practitioner representative for payroll taxes, submitting EMP201s monthly and EMP501 reconciliations in the August and February filing seasons directly on SARS eFiling.
